Quarterly Returns with Monthly Payment (QRMP) Scheme The Central Board of Indirect Taxes & Customs (CBIC) introduced Quarterly Return Filing and Monthly Payment of Taxes (QRMP) scheme under Goods and Services Tax (GST) to help the taxpayers having turnover less than Rs. 5 crores. GST compensation shortfall released to States reaches Rs. 1.04 Lakh crore. 18th Instalment of Rs. 4,000 crore released to the States on Monday, 1st March, 2021. 94 percent of the estimated shortfall released
I am happy to note that the anti-evasion teams of Jaipur and Alwar CGST Commissionerates have used data analytics to unearth a large case of fraudulent ITC availment, involving fake invoices with a face value of Rs. 3308 crore by several non-existent firms registered in Jaipur. These firms had fraudulently availed ITC of about Rs. 83.37 crore and also passed on ITC of Rs 85.26 crore. So far, eight persons have been arrested and further investigations are in progress.
